How much do entry level revenue growth management j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level revenue growth management in the United States is $120,205.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$87,000.00 and $150,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Entry Level Revenue Growth Management vs Entry Level Sales Analyst?

AspectEntry Level Revenue Growth ManagementEntry Level Sales Analyst
Primary FocusOptimizing revenue streams, pricing strategies, and market shareAnalyzing sales data, forecasting, and supporting sales strategies
Required SkillsData analysis, strategic thinking, understanding of pricing and marketingData analysis, reporting, sales performance metrics
Work EnvironmentCross-functional teams, marketing, finance, and sales departmentsSales teams, marketing, and data analysis units
Common CertificationsBusiness, marketing, or finance degrees; analytical certificationsBusiness, marketing, or analytics degrees; Excel and data tools proficiency

While both roles involve data analysis and support for revenue and sales, Entry Level Revenue Growth Management focuses on strategic revenue optimization across multiple functions, whereas Entry Level Sales Analyst primarily concentrates on analyzing sales data and supporting sales strategies. Understanding these differences helps candidates align their skills and career goals effectively.

What does the Junior Revenue Growth Management Analyst do at Swire Coca-Cola?

The Junior Revenue Growth Management Analyst supports revenue growth for Swire Coca-Cola through volume growth, pricing changes, and promotional activity analysis. Working closely with Revenue Growth Management (RGM) leadership, providing analysis on pricing and revenue decisions by producing reports that visualize the performance of joint business plans. Using your understanding of data management, data analysis, pricing processes, and report creation you will impact the volume and sales goals of the organization.


Responsibilities:

  • Drive revenue accuracy through various activities including: retailer pricing submissions, internal pricing integrity audits, and master data accuracy
  • Validate and track promotional spending to deliver optimal results and determine ROI of promotional investments
  • Evaluate trends to support forecasting accuracy for customers and channels to identify forward-looking risks and opportunities
  • Analyze sales data to grow volume, revenue, and Swire Coca-Cola's share in key beverage categories


Requirements:

  • Bachelor's Degree required
  • Large and complex data set experience producing reports and insights
  • Report creation experience Power Bi, Tableau, DOMO, or similar reporting tools
  • Proficiency with Azure or other cloud providers to facilitate data pulls and technical business conversations preferred
  • Experience with Python, SQL, VBA, R or other languages to work cross-functionally with IT, Data Science, and other technical teams preferred
